GT downhill mountain bicycles recalled over injury risk
- Recall date
- May 28, 2015
- Source
- U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C)
- Official notice title
- Cycling Sports Group Recalls GT Fury Mountain Bicycles Due to Crash, Injury Hazards
- Recall number
- 15152
- Sold / distributed
- Authorized GT dealers from November 2014 to March 2015 for between $3200 and $4400.
Why it was recalled
The front wheel hub can break and cause the disc brake system to fail, posing crash and injury hazards to the consumer.
What was recalled
This recall involves all 2015 model year GT Fury Elite and GT Fury Expert downhill mountain bicycles. The recalled 2015 Fury Elite model is white with blue and red accents. The recalled 2015 Fury Expert model is metallic grey with lime green accents. The bicycles have front and rear disc brakes and come with rear shock absorbers and front suspensions. "Fury" is printed on the top tube, the GT logo is on the down tube and the chainstay. The model names are printed in small letters on the top tube of the bicycles near the word Fury.
What to do
Consumers should immediately stop using the recalled bicycles and return them to the nearest authorized GT dealer to have the complete front wheel replaced free of charge.. Follow the official notice for full instructions.
